On Fri, 14 Oct 2016, Jeroen Demeyer wrote:
As far as I know, the only real use-case for milestone is a milestone like
`sage-duplicate/invalid/wontfix` or `sage-pending`. I think that every
milestone of the form `sage-X.Y` is essentially treated equivalently.
I normally use "sage-N" and mark myself as the author when I plan to do
something in near future, and "sage-(N+1)" rarely when I guess that
version N will be out before I got something done. I have used
"sage-wishlist" few times when I have an idea. If I report a bug, I use
"sage-N" and left author-field empty if I am not sure that I'll make patch
myself.
* * *
But we don't have any plans like "Version 8 will be out about q1/2018 and
will have mostly more support for numerical linear algebra.", and so
milestones are not really used.
